Official | Arsenal’s William Saliba pulls out of the France squad with ankle injury, Benjamin Pavard called up – Yahoo Sports

Arsenal’s promising defender William Saliba has withdrawn from the French national team due to an ankle injury, raising concerns ahead of the upcoming international fixtures. The decision comes as France prepares for vital matches, prompting coach Didier Deschamps to call up Bayern Munich’s Benjamin Pavard as a replacement. Saliba’s absence will test the depth of France’s defense, as the young star has been instrumental for both his club and country.
